Faizan Ahmed's Death Mystery: New Forensic Report Reveals Disturbing Details in IIT Kharagpur Student's Death

The death of Faizan Ahmed, a 24-year-old student from IIT Kharagpur, initially ruled as suicide in 2022, has taken a dramatic turn with new forensic evidence indicating murder. Discrepancies pointed out by Ahmed's family led to a court-ordered second autopsy.

In a significant development regarding the death of Faizan Ahmed, a 24-year-old student from the prestigious Indian Institute of Technology (IIT) Kharagpur, new forensic evidence suggests foul play. This revelation comes after a second autopsy, commissioned by the Calcutta High Court, shed new light on the circumstances surrounding his death, originally reported in 2022.

Ahmed was discovered dead in his hostel room in West Bengal's Paschim Medinipur district on October 14, 2022. The initial assumption was suicide, but discrepancies raised by Ahmed’s family led to a deeper investigation.

The first investigation by the college authorities concluded that Ahmed had committed suicide. However, his parents suspected foul play and petitioned the Calcutta High Court for a more thorough investigation. The court responded by authorising the exhumation of Ahmed's body to re-examine the case.

A second autopsy performed by forensic expert Ajoy Kumar Gupta, a retired officer from the West Bengal Crime Investigation Department, has now provided critical insights. Gupta's findings, released earlier this month, indicated that Ahmed suffered severe trauma inflicted by blunt objects, stabbing, and a gunshot wound near his left ear. These findings starkly contrast the initial suicide conclusion, suggesting that Ahmed was indeed murdered.

In June 2023, Gupta's preliminary examination concluded that Ahmed succumbed to hemorrhagic shock, caused by significant bleeding. Further, a detailed analysis in May 2024, after reviewing the Central Forensic Science Laboratory reports, revealed additional chilling details: the right temporal styloid process was missing, the left styloid process had turned black, and there was blood evidence near the mandible and second cervical vertebrae. Gupta stated these injuries likely resulted from a stabbing on the right side and a gunshot wound inflicted at close range below the left ear.

The initial post-mortem, conducted on October 15, 2022, had failed to pinpoint the cause of death conclusively. In contrast, the second examination, performed in May 2023 in Kolkata, provides compelling evidence of homicide. Gupta's detailed report is expected to be presented to the Calcutta High Court next month.

As the final report is awaited, Faizan Ahmed's family continues to seek justice for their son, hopeful that the new findings will prompt a re-evaluation of the case by the authorities.
